Overview of the Topic

The job of an excavating operator in agriculture involves operating heavy machinery such as backhoes, bulldozers, and excavators. These machines help in tasks like digging trenches for irrigation systems, leveling land for crop planting, and clearing fields for new projects. The skill set needed for this job is diverse; beyond just knowing how to operate machinery, one also needs a strong understanding of land management and effective communication skills to collaborate with agronomists and farmers.

Importance in Agriculture/Horticulture/Agronomy

The significance of excavating operators goes beyond mere machinery operation. They are crucial in ensuring projects are done in a timely manner and according to specific agricultural needs. For instance, during land preparation, their role directly contributes to soil health, which is essential for robust crop yields. Without proper excavation and land management, the agricultural landscape could suffer from poor drainage and erosion, undermining years of farming efforts. Defining Excavating Operators

An excavating operator is generally defined as a skilled individual who operates heavy machinery to clear land, build roads, or dig trenches. In agriculture, their tasks are often tailored specifically to meet farming needs. This role may encompass various types of machinery, such as excavators, bulldozers, and backhoes.

While the term may seem simple, the intricacies of the job require a unique blend of operational knowledge, machine mechanics, and an understanding of agricultural needs. When one thinks of an excavating operator, it's easy to conjure an image of someone behind the wheel of a massive piece of equipment, but it’s this nuanced understanding of terrain, crop needs, and project requirements that sets skilled operators apart.

Core Responsibilities

The responsibilities of an excavating operator in agriculture can be quite diverse, varying from project to project. Here are some of the primary tasks:

  • Land Preparation: This includes clearing paths, leveling surfaces, and grading earth to create optimal conditions for farming. This preliminary step is critical in establishing a fruitful growing environment.
  • Trenching and Digging: Operators create trenches for irrigation systems, pipelines, and drainage solutions. The proper installation of these systems ensures that water resources are managed effectively.
  • Harvesting Support: Some operators may also assist in setting up or taking down crop-specific equipment during the harvest season, which requires coordination and timing.
  • Routine Maintenance: The heavy machinery used can undergo significant wear and tear. Operators must perform regular checks and minor repairs to ensure everything operates smoothly.
  • Collaboration: Excavating operators often work closely with other agricultural professionals. Their insights can help in planning projects that maximize efficiency and output.

Modern Excavating Equipment

Modern excavating equipment has come a long way from the days of manual land clearing. Today’s machines are designed with enhanced functionalities tailored to meet the specific needs of agricultural operations. For instance, large excavators from brands like Caterpillar or Komatsu come with advanced hydraulic systems that allow precision movements, crucial when working around crops to avoid damage. This precision can greatly enhance productivity while lowering the likelihood of equipment failure, which can be costly both in time and money.

Moreover, tractors equipped with GPS technology can track various factors such as soil quality and topography, ensuring that excavators are used only where necessary. This not only optimizes resources but also supports environmental sustainability by reducing excess soil disruption. For operators, familiarity with these sophisticated machines isn't just a benefit; it's often a requirement in job descriptions.

  • Excavators: Versatile machines that dig, lift, and transport earth and materials.
  • Bulldozers: Excellent for pushing large volumes of soil, particularly during land leveling tasks.
  • Backhoes: Highly useful for smaller jobs requiring both digging and lifting capabilities.

In addition, operators should consider equipment maintenance as a critical part of their duties. Regular servicing keeps machinery in good working order, extending its lifespan and ensuring safety on the job site.

Innovations in Technology

Innovations are reshaping excavation practices in the agricultural sector, making tasks more efficient and safer. One notable advancement is the integration of telematics—technology that monitors equipment performance remotely. For example, operators can receive real-time data on fuel consumption and operating hours. This data is invaluable for both optimizing machine use and for environmental tracking in farming operations.

Drones, too, have revolutionized land assessment before excavation begins. These flying devices can survey large fields quickly, offering crucial insights into soil conditions and topography. Additionally, drones can assist in progress monitoring through aerial imagery, helping operators adjust their strategies in real time. Such technological integrations are not just fads; they are becoming essential components of modern excavation practices.

Another important innovation is the development of eco-friendly equipment. As sustainability becomes a priority in agriculture, machines that reduce emissions or use alternative fuels are gaining traction. For instance, hybrid excavators and electric machinery are starting to appear in the market, which aligns with the agricultural community’s growing commitment to responsible practices.

Sustainable Excavation Techniques

Sustainable excavation techniques are paramount in minimizing environmental impact while maximizing agricultural efficiency. These methods can include:

  • Minimal Disturbance: Excavating operators should use techniques such as contour trenching where soil is disturbed only as much as necessary. This helps to maintain soil integrity and promotes better water retention.
  • Soil Conservation: Operators can employ practices like double digging or laser grading, which improve soil structure and reduce erosion. Maintaining soil quality is vital for crop health, and careful excavation promotes both.
  • Organic Soil Management: Incorporating organic matter during excavation enhances soil fertility naturally. This approach is increasingly important for farmers aiming to reduce chemical inputs.
  • Erosion Control Measures: Before and after excavation, implementing erosion control methods—like planting cover crops—helps stabilize the soil and minimizes runoff.

By employing these techniques, excavating operators contribute to healthier ecosystems, thus supporting sustainable agriculture.

Physical Demands of the Job

Working as an excavating operator is no walk in the park. The job requires both physical fitness and stamina. Operators are required to spend long hours on machinery, often in extreme weather conditions. From summer’s heat to winter's freezing cold, they deal with it all.

More importantly, the act of maneuvering heavy equipment like bulldozers and backhoes requires substantial upper body strength and overall endurance. Operators must maintain focus and coordination, which can be exhausting over a lengthy workday. Additionally, operating heavy machinery can lead to fatigue, particularly if one doesn't manage breaks effectively. This occupational fatigue can increase the risk of accidents, making it crucial to cultivate personal resilience and proper rest habits.

"The body bears the scars of each day’s labor, and every operator learns to listen to it closely."

Work Environment Hazards

The hazards present in the work environment for excavating operators can be daunting. These are not just mere inconveniences; they can pose serious risks that operators must respect.

Operating machinery near trenches and excavation sites brings forth the danger of collapse. Soil erosion can catch even the most seasoned operator off-guard, and a moment's lapse in attention can have dire consequences. They are also often exposed to various safety risks, including:

  • Heavy Equipment: The machinery is powerful but can be dangerous without proper training and precautions. Operators must always follow standard operating procedures (SOP) to mitigate risks.
  • Noise Pollution: Constant exposure to loud machinery can lead to hearing impairment over time. Hence, operators often need to wear protective ear gear to shield themselves from long-term damage.
  • Chemical Exposure: Depending on the project's nature, operators may come into contact with chemicals such as pesticides or fuels, necessitating proper safety gear and understanding of safe handling procedures.
  • Visibility Issues: Dust or poor lighting can severely impair an operator's visibility, increasing the potential for accidents. Operators must be vigilant and adaptive, often relying on their instinct and experience to navigate these environments safely.

Geographic Demand Differences

The demand for excavating operators largely hinges on the agricultural practices prevalent in specific regions. For instance, in areas where large-scale industrial farming prevails, such as the Midwest of the United States, the need for operators is typically higher. States like Iowa and Illinois leverage sophisticated machinery for planting and harvesting, thereby increasing the demand for skilled operators who can operate heavy equipment adeptly.

Overview of job market trends for excavating operators
Overview of job market trends for excavating operators

Conversely, in regions characterized by small-scale, localized farms, the demand might not be as pronounced. In New England, where diversified farming practices are more common, excavating operators may find themselves involved in smaller projects including construction of farm structures or preparation of land for community gardens.

Another layer to consider is the impact of environmental regulations and sustainability efforts, which can fluctuate by region. Places with stringent environmental policies may require more skilled personnel to navigate the complexities of sustainable excavation practices. The bottom line is, knowing where demand is strong can direct an aspiring operator's job search toward regions where their skills are most needed.

"Regional variations significantly influence demand; a savvy operator must keep their ear to the ground to find the best opportunities."

Regional Salary Expectations

When it comes to the compensation of excavating operators, regional variations also play a key role. In high-demand areas, salaries may reflect not only the local cost of living but also the competition for these skilled jobs. For instance, in parts of California where agriculture is driven by high-value crops like almonds and lettuce, wages can be higher. Operators in these regions often enjoy salaries that exceed the national average, driven by the profitability of the crops and the efficiency that skilled operators bring to the operation.

On the flip side, salaries may be lower in regions where farming is more traditional and less mechanized. Areas in the southern United States might see lower wages due to economic conditions, limited budgets for farm operations, or reduced reliance on heavy machinery in favor of traditional methods.
